AI赋能工业设备预测性维护:从数据采集到智能决策的全链路实践

一、传统维护模式困境与智能转型必要性

1.1 维护模式效能对比分析

在汽车焊装线等高价值生产场景中,设备停机成本呈现指数级增长。某大型制造企业的实际数据显示:采用事后维护模式时,单次故障平均导致12-36小时停机,年度维护成本基准值为100%;切换至定期维护后,停机时间缩短至4-8小时,但维护成本仍达70%,且备件库存冗余高达60-80%。

相比之下,AI预测性维护通过部署振动、温度、电流等100+类传感器,结合机器学习模型实现:

  • 故障预警提前期:3-30天精准预测
  • 维护成本降低:40-50%优化幅度
  • 停机时间压缩:90%以上减少率
  • 备件库存优化:10-20%合理水平

1.2 智能维护技术经济价值

以年产30万辆汽车的焊装线为例,每分钟停机损失约合1.2万欧元。通过部署预测性维护系统,某企业实现:

  • 设备综合效率(OEE)提升18%
  • 非计划停机减少72%
  • 年度维护费用节省超400万欧元
  • 备件周转率提升3倍

二、端到端技术架构设计

2.1 分层架构体系

构建”边缘-云端-终端”三级架构:

  1. 边缘层:部署工业网关实现数据预处理,采用FPGA加速的轻量级模型进行实时推理(延迟<50ms)
  2. 传输层:通过MQTT/OPC-UA协议实现设备数据标准化,Kafka消息队列保障数据可靠性
  3. 云端层
    • 数据湖:存储TB级时序数据
    • 特征平台:基于PySpark构建流式特征工程管道
    • 模型训练:PyTorch Lightning框架实现分布式训练
    • 决策引擎:OptaPlanner优化维护工单调度
  4. 应用层:数字孪生系统实现设备状态可视化,Grafana构建监控看板

2.2 闭环优化机制

建立”感知-分析-决策-反馈”的增强循环:

  1. 现场维修数据通过CMMS系统回流
  2. 自动标注工具更新故障标签库
  3. 模型再训练管道每周迭代更新
  4. A/B测试框架验证新模型效果

某钢铁企业实践表明,该闭环机制使模型准确率从82%持续提升至94%,误报率降低67%。

三、工业数据工程实施路径

3.1 智能传感器部署策略

针对不同设备类型制定差异化方案:
| 设备类型 | 关键测点 | 采样策略 | 典型故障模式 |
|————————|—————————————-|—————————————-|———————————-|
| 伺服电机 | 驱动端轴承XYZ向振动 | 10kHz包络解调 | 外圈点蚀、保持架损坏 |
| 液压系统 | 压力/温度/流量三参数 | 100Hz P-T图分析 | 密封件泄漏、油液污染 |
| CNC加工中心 | 主轴加速度+声发射 | 25kHz小波包分解 | 刀具磨损、主轴不平衡 |

3.2 流式特征工程实践

基于PySpark Streaming构建实时特征管道:

  1. from pyspark.sql import SparkSession
  2. from pyspark.sql.functions import udf, col
  3. from pyspark.sql.types import ArrayType, DoubleType
  4. import pywt
  5. import numpy as np
  6. spark = SparkSession.builder.appName("IndustrialFeature").getOrCreate()
  7. # 小波特征提取UDF
  8. @udf(returnType=ArrayType(DoubleType()))
  9. def extract_wavelet_features(signal):
  10. coeffs, _ = pywt.cwt(signal, scales=np.arange(1,32), wavelet='morl')
  11. return [np.mean(c) for c in coeffs]
  12. # 构建流处理管道
  13. df = spark.readStream.format("kafka") \
  14. .option("subscribe", "sensor_data") \
  15. .load()
  16. features = df.selectExpr("timestamp", "device_id",
  17. "explode(array(vibration_x, vibration_y)) as signal") \
  18. .withColumn("wavelet_features", extract_wavelet_features(col("signal")))
  19. # 写入特征存储
  20. query = features.writeStream \
  21. .outputMode("append") \
  22. .format("parquet") \
  23. .start("/features/wavelet")

3.3 剩余寿命预测模型

采用多模态融合架构提升预测精度:

  1. 时序模型:LSTM网络处理振动信号时序特征
  2. 图像模型:CNN分析频谱图空间特征
  3. 多任务学习:联合预测RUL和故障类型
  4. 注意力机制:动态加权关键特征时段

某风电企业应用表明,该架构使RUL预测误差从28%降至9%,故障分类F1值达0.92。

四、典型行业实施案例

4.1 汽车制造焊装线

某德系车企部署方案:

  • 部署2000+个振动/温度传感器
  • 构建设备数字孪生体
  • 实现焊接机器人关键部件RUL预测
  • 维护工单自动生成率提升80%

4.2 半导体晶圆厂

某12英寸产线实施效果:

  • 光刻机真空系统泄漏预测准确率97%
  • 化学气相沉积设备故障预警提前量达14天
  • 年度非计划停机减少65小时

4.3 能源行业风机群

某风电运营商实践:

  • 叶片结冰预测模型召回率91%
  • 齿轮箱故障预测提前量21天
  • 运维成本降低42%

五、实施挑战与应对策略

5.1 数据质量治理

建立”采集-清洗-标注-验证”闭环:

  1. 部署边缘计算节点进行异常值过滤
  2. 采用GAN生成合成数据解决样本不平衡
  3. 构建自动化标注平台提升标签质量

5.2 模型可解释性

采用SHAP值分析关键特征贡献度,生成可视化报告:

  1. import shap
  2. explainer = shap.DeepExplainer(model)
  3. shap_values = explainer.shap_values(test_data)
  4. shap.summary_plot(shap_values, test_data, feature_names=feature_list)

5.3 系统集成复杂度

采用工业协议转换网关实现:

  • Modbus TCP到OPC UA的协议转换
  • 不同厂商设备数据标准化
  • 与MES/ERP系统的API对接

六、未来发展趋势

  1. 边缘智能进化:TinyML技术使模型在PLC中直接运行
  2. 物理信息融合:结合设备物理模型提升预测可靠性
  3. 自主维护系统:机器人自动执行简单维修任务
  4. 碳感知维护:将能耗优化纳入维护决策维度

结语:AI预测性维护正在重塑工业维护范式,通过构建数据驱动的智能决策体系,帮助企业实现从被动响应到主动预防的转型。实施过程中需重点关注数据质量治理、模型可解释性、系统集成等关键环节,结合行业特性制定差异化方案。随着5G+边缘计算技术的普及,预测性维护将向更实时、更精准、更自主的方向演进。